Most helpful comment

Expected is:

  1. Ticket orders that use online payment methods (credit card, paypal) should be labeled as "pending" until they are paid and expire after 1 day.
  2. Ticket orders that use offline payment methods (bank, cheque) should be labeled as "Placed" once the user has hit the button "order". These user need to pay offline. This is only the case if the organizer has specified offline payment.
